The size of Merewether is approximately 6.4 square kilometres. It has 19 parks covering nearly 49.5% of total area. The population of Merewether in 2016 was 10964 people. By 2021 the population was 11788 showing a population growth of 7.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Merewether is 20-29 years. Households in Merewether are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Merewether work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.80% of the homes in Merewether were owner-occupied compared with 63.30% in 2016.
